Eventing Medal Program
To qualify for SCDCTA Medals and performance certificates the following criteria must be met:
- Rider was an active member of SCDCTA in good standing at time of show.
- Horse was registered with SCDCTA at time of show.
- For schooling shows, the show must be SCDCTA approved.
- Scores may be used beginning with the 2011 competition year.
Requirements for Submission of Scores:
- The fronts of score sheets MUST be photocopied and the following information MUST be
included: horse’s name, rider, date, score, name of show (must be SCDCTA or USEA) and test used, dressage score and overall penalty points.
- When complete, riders must submit SCDCTA Horse Trial Awards Form, Test sheets and send
to current CT/Horse Trial Coordinator.
- Medals may be on more than one horse (with the exception of the Certificate of Achievement).
- There is no time limit as to when the scores have to be earned other than no scores prior to the 2011 season can be used.
- Scores must be submitted by the deadline for eventing awards in order to be awarded that year.
Certificate of Achievement
Awarded for completing five (5) horse trials at any level Ameoba-Advanced. This is a horse
award and one certificate per level can be earned by an individual horse.
Blue Ribbon
Awarded to the rider for placing 1st through 6th at three (3) Beginner Novice level horse trials.
Medallion Award
Awarded to the rider for placing 1st through 6th at three (3) Novice level horse trials.
Bronze Medal
Awarded to the rider for placing 1st through 6th at three (3) Training level horse trials.
Silver Medal
Awarded to the rider for placing 1st through 6th at three (3) Preliminary level horse trials,
including two-day events, and one-star three day events.
Gold Medal
Awarded to the rider for placing 1st through 6th at three (3) Intermediate or Advanced level
Horse Trials, including two-day events, and three and four star three-day events.
